The Gno-key to My Heart

Hunting & Gathering

Buried deep down on the very tip of Burns Court Cafe's dinner menu, you'll find a dish that could easily be forgotten or simply passed over for better things. The austere description reads only: "Gnocchi in coconut milk and saffron sauce." And yet, big things are in store for all who order, especially those who live without dairy (either by choice or necessity). Instead of watered-down wannabe cream sauce that the lactose-less normally encounter, this effortlessly smooth, fawn-colored emulsion holds deep notes of nutty warmth, only accentuated by the blood-orange saffron dust—otherwise known as the most expensive spice in the world. The little plate all at once captures the essence of churned sweetness alongside the exotic, bitter florals of the coral spice, combining to form a pungent, yet light pasta plate.

 

Burns Court Cafe, 401 South Pineapple Ave., Sarasota, 941-312-6633.
